Six Japanese Pen-form Metal Portable Writing Sets, Yatate
LATE 19TH/EARLY 20TH CENTURY
the first a brass example, together with a circular ink reservoir decorated with mix-metal shell-form inlays; the second another brass example chiseled with diaper cells, together with a bronze circular ink reservoir inset with an iron top decorated with a rat; the third also a brass example together with an inro-form ink reservoir; the fourth and the fifth two bronze examples, one with an inro-form ink reservoir, the other a jar shaped; the sixth a silver example with an inro-style ink reservoir.
Average length 8 in., 20 cm.
